Improved Window bar
Here's an option for improving the coloured window bars, which are so characteristic of this building.
The yellow horizontal bar across the windows on the north side is continuous across the width of the building.
This is difficult to achieve all the way across because it's an odd number of bricks in my model and there is no LEGO part that contains the 'slide' edge that is an odd number of studs long (they only come in plates with 2 studs and 8 studs). So to fill this I've used one small plate jutting out from the wall. It sticks out slightly but doesn't look too bad. If only there was a 1x1 or a 1x3 plate with a slide! That would help with the front red bar also. The alternative would be to scale the model up slightly to make it an even number of studs, if it wouldn't distort the proportions too much.
